About The Author
Mark Hasara
Mark Hasara operated the Boeing KC-135 Stratotanker for twenty-four years in the Air Force. His career began during the Reagan Administration, supporting Strategic Air Command’s nuclear deterrent mission. In August 1990, he moved to Okinawa, Japan, flying missions across the Pacific Rim and Southeast Asia. He participated in combat missions during Desert Shield and Desert Storm. As a Duty Officer in the Tanker Airlift Control Center, he managed five hundred monthly airlift and air refueling missions. After retiring from the Air Force, Mark worked at Rockwell Collins for seven years in engineering, designing military aircraft cockpits. He became a full-time author and defense industry consultant in 2014.
